What is it called when a group of workers and managers from a particular production area who make suggestions for production improvement?

This is typically referred to as a "quality circle." Quality circles are small groups of workers and managers who meet regularly to discuss and suggest improvements in production processes, quality, and efficiency. They aim to enhance workplace conditions and productivity through collaborative problem-solving and continuous improvement initiatives.

What is the Difference Between Quality Circles and Work Council?

Quality Circles are small groups of employees who meet regularly to discuss workplace improvement, solve problems, and enhance productivity, focusing primarily on quality management and operational efficiency. In contrast, Works Councils are formal bodies representing employees' interests in a company, often involved in broader issues such as working conditions, labor relations, and company policies. While Quality Circles aim to foster continuous improvement and innovation, Works Councils serve a legal and organizational role in ensuring employee representation and participation in decision-making processes.

What is the philosophy of Joseph Juran?

One important philosophy is Juran's trilogy.Juran's Trilogy is an approach to cross functional management that is composed of three managerial processes: planning, control, and improvement.
